I recently bought a 2nd hand washing machine, when it was delivered there was no plug attached, just the standard 3 wires and a wire holder.

I pulled the plug off an old power strip and attached it to the end of the washer.

I got nervous when I read the wire holder, It said 25A, the plug is 13A fused, and the socket is 20A.

Will this work or will I need to change it?

I could not find anything on the washer regarding its electrical input.

Best Answer

The markings on the terminal block should indicate the rating of the terminal block, not the electrical consuption of the appliance.

Also, washers usually do not consume more than 1,000 watts or so; at 120Vac things would be fine given about 8-9 amps current draw @ 1,000 watts. At 240Vac, you should be golden with a current draw of 4-5 amps.
